The purpose of this study was to provide data to the US Forest Service about summer recreational use of the Wenaha Wild and Scenic River in , and to determine if use and use levels were appropriate according to relevant legislation and policies. The Umatilla National Forest is the administrative authority of the river and is required to complete a Comprehensive River Management Plan for this river. At the time of data collection this Draft Environmental Analysis (EA) was being developed. The Final EA was implemented July, 2015. Recreation surveys were collected at trailheads and other developed and undeveloped recreation areas that access the river corridor during the summer of 2014. The survey instrument asked visitors questions pertaining to sociodemographic items, group size and composition, trip characteristics, satisfaction with facilities and services, motivations to visit, and perceptions of crowding and conflict. Visitors were also asked about activities they participated in and where they recreated in the study . Vehicle counts at trailheads were conducted to provide additional data about visitor capacity for the river and Wenaha-Tucannon Wilderness, which encompassed part of the study area. Observational data was recorded as supplementary if it was determined to be inconsistent with relevant management plans. Quantitative data was analyzed in concert with relevant guiding documents and policies to determine if recreational use and use levels were appropriate for the study area, which included lands managed by the US Forest Service, Bureau of Land Management, state of Oregon, and private lands. The document review included analysis of federal legislation (Wilderness Act and Wild and Scenic Rivers Act), management plans (Forest Service, Bureau of Land Management, Oregon Department of Fish and Wildlife and county plans) and policies (including Forest Service directives, public use (fire) restrictions, and Oregon Parks and Recreation Administrative Rules). The Appropriate Use Protocol developed by Haas and the Federal Interagency Task Force on Visitor Capacity on Public Lands (2002) was used to determine if use and use levels were appropriate. Quantitative data supported the conclusion that recreational use and use levels were appropriate in this low-use, highly protected area. Supplementary qualitative data included a small number of observations pertaining to vehicle and campsite use that were inconsistent with standards or guidelines as defined by legislation, management plans, or policies that apply in the area. iii

Outdoor Recreation Research

The second half of the twentieth century was characterized by a period of economic prosperity and security for many Americans, which resulted in an increase in leisure time (Siehl

2008, USDA, 2005). As Americans developed an interest in protected lands, many conservationists, land managers, and scholars developed a growing concern for how increasing numbers of visitors were impacting the natural environment. This was not entirely new;

Frederick Law Olmsted recognized this problem in his report on the management of Yosemite

National Park in 1865 (Roper, 1952). However, the United States now had a larger population, with many citizens owning automobiles and therefore able to easily access public lands for recreational purposes. These recreationists might not only interfere with the health of the natural environments they visited, but could potentially interfere with each other in their enjoyment of these public lands (Lime & Stankey, 1971; Wagar, 1964). Wagar’s (1964) discussion of this 2 social carrying capacity was an initial cornerstone for much outdoor recreation research, particularly with regard to Wilderness and the concept of crowding, both of which are important to this thesis.

The U.S. Forest Service

The background for the development of the Forest Service began during the second half of the nineteenth century as scholars and citizens in the United States questioned the sustainability of their natural resources due to certain land management practices. The 1891

Forest Reserve Act was an early piece of legislation which would attempt to address these concerns by granting the President of the United States authority to set aside specific public lands to be protected for the future. With the Transfer Act of 1905, administrative responsibility of these reserves was moved from the Department of the Interior to the Department of

Agriculture, and the Forest Service was born (USDA, 2005).

As the first Chief Forester, approached the task with a utilitarian philosophy to manage for “the greatest good, for the greatest number, for the longest time”

(2005). The young agency developed quickly as a result of Pinchot’s work combined with

Theodore Roosevelt’s political support and addition of approximately 100 million acres of Forest

Service land during his presidency (2005). Today, the Forest Service has grown to manage 193 million acres of land in the United States. Management is guided by a rich tapestry of legislation informed by improvements in science and an increasingly diverse and interested public, all with the goal of striking the delicate balance required to manage this “land of many uses.” The

Multiple Use Sustained Yield Act (1960) specified these “uses” for which the Forest Service is responsible to manage: wood, water, forage, wildlife, and recreation. This paper focuses on the 3 legislation, policies, and tools which are relevant to Forest Service management of recreation in the study area.

The Wilderness Act and the Wild and Scenic Rivers Act

The American political environment of the 1960s and 1970s quickly and drastically shaped the future of land management in the United States. This period gave rise to the Clean

Water Act (1972), Endangered Species Act (1973), and Forest and Rangeland Renewable

Resources Planning Act (1974) in just three short years (USDA, 2005). Two key laws from this period were important for this thesis: the Wilderness Act of 1964 and the Wild and Scenic Rivers

Act of 1968.

The year 2014 marked the 50th anniversary of the Wilderness Act. Approximately five pages long, this document is arguably the most significant piece of legislation to federal land managers in the United States. It defines Wilderness, in part, as “an area where the earth and its community of life are untrammeled by man, where man himself is a visitor who does not remain” (Wilderness Act section 2 (c)).These lands are the most highly protected lands of the

United States, as use of these areas is most restricted and the terms of the Wilderness Act supersede those of other land management laws. Policy development, management plans, and day-to-day decisions are guided by the Act for all designated lands, including the Wenaha-

Tucannon Wilderness which constitutes a large part of the study area.

The Wild and Scenic Rivers Act was signed into law just four years after the Wilderness

Act, also reflecting contemporary public interest. The “big era” that had provided jobs and hydroelectric power in a post-war economy was ending, and Americans were looking at the value of rivers differently (Billington, Jackson, & Melosi, 2005). The Wild and Scenic Rivers

Act states that designated rivers “shall be preserved in free-flowing condition, and that they and 4 their immediate environments shall be protected for the benefit and enjoyment of present and future generations” (Wild and Scenic Rivers Act section 1(b)). To be designated, a river must possess at least one “outstandingly remarkable value” which has been defined as "a unique, rare, or exemplary feature that is significant at a comparative regional or national scale” (USDA,

2015). Whether or not a river possesses such a value is to be determined by science conducted by a federal land management agency which manages that river. The Wenaha Wild and Scenic

River was designated in 1988 and the Forest Service determined it to possess four outstandingly remarkable values: recreation, scenery, wildlife, and fisheries (USDA, 1992).

Background of the Study Area

The Umatilla NF is located in the Northwest of the United States, encompassing

1.4 million acres of the Blue Mountain region of northeastern Oregon and southeastern

Washington. Elevation ranges from 1,600 – 8,000 feet, providing diversity for both wildlife habitat and recreational opportunities. Winters are long and some areas of the Forest are inaccessible through early summer due to snowpack. Summer days in the lower elevations can reach well over 100F. Tree species include , ponderosa pine, and .

Hundreds of miles of rivers and streams provide habitat for fish species such as , , chinook , and steelhead. These forests and waters support an array of terrestrial wildlife species including large mammals such as mountain lion, black bear, , , and white-tail and mule . The Forest boasts one of the largest populations of Rocky Mountain in the United States (USDA, 2013a).

The study area for this thesis included the Wenaha Wild and Scenic River and areas which access the river corridor. The federally designated portion of the river is 21.55 miles long, and begins where the north and south forks meet as they flow east from the Blue Mountains. 5

There are 18.7 river miles within the Forest boundary, and 15.2 of these miles are also within the

Wenaha-Tucannon Wilderness (Wilderness) (USDA, 2013b). This majority of the river corridor is characterized by remote wild landscapes. The river itself is relatively shallow and narrow and in many areas, dependent on time of year, one can cross it on foot with ease. It is not typically used for floating. Most of the river runs through a deep valley, with slopes on either side rising up to 2,000 feet to ridges. outcroppings and varying forest density are visible on the slopes from the river. At the last river mile, the community of Troy, Oregon greets the mouth of the

Wenaha just before its with the Grande Ronde Wild and Scenic River.

Though the majority of the river is contained within the Umatilla NF boundary, 2.85 miles of the Wenaha also run through lands managed by a variety of entities, including the

Bureau of Land Management (BLM), the Oregon Department of Fish and Wildlife (ODFW), and private landowners. BLM-managed land includes several parcels within the corridor. ODFW also manages several parcels, including the and a public campground just across the river from Troy. Within Troy, private homeowners have land within the corridor, and one couple owns and operates the Shilo Troy Resort, which includes seven developed campsites on the bank of the Wenaha just before it meets the Grande Ronde.

The Oregon Omnibus National Wild and Scenic Rivers Act of 1988 amended the Wild and Scenic Rivers Act of 1968, granting federally-protected status to dozens of Oregon rivers and river segments and naming the Forest Serviceas ultimately responsible for the protection of the Wenaha (section 102). The Umatilla NF was thereby required to develop a Comprehensive

River Management Plan for the river. However, the Forest Service may not enforce its rules outside of its boundaries. This means that it must work with other agencies and stakeholders in 6 order to ensure that river values are protected on the 2.9 river miles which extend beyond the

Forest boundary.

Recreational Opportunities

The unique location and geography of the Umatilla NF allows for a variety of recreational opportunities. Fishing and big-game hunting are two of the primary recreational activities for the river (USDA, 1992). Over 30,000 big-game hunters visit the Forest each year, primarily as a result of an abundance of elk, tags for which are highly sought after by hunters throughout the U.S. (USDA, 2013a). Deer and elk seasons range from late August through late

September. The entire Wenaha corridor is enveloped by one hunting unit which is administered by the Oregon Department of Fish and Wildlife (ODFW). The unit just north of the corridor lies in and is managed by the Washington Department of Fish and Wildlife.

Anglers are also provided with unique opportunities in the corridor. The Wenaha’s clean and cold fast-running waters create excellent habitat for a variety of fish. Fishing is also regulated by the ODFW, who manages special wild populations carefully; chinook salmon, steelhead, and bull trout are listed as threatened by the U.S. Fish and Wildlife Service (USFWS,

2015). Anglers are rewarded year-round on the river, but steelhead fishing in the fall is especially popular.

Both the Forest Service and ODFW have recognized that although hunting and fishing have dominated recreation in the area, there has been an increase in hiking, horseback riding, and other recreational activities in recent years (ODFW, 2007; USDA, 2013b). Camping is often an activity which takes place in the Wenaha corridor as complementary to these primary activities, or as a primary activity on its own.

Limitations

There were three primary limitations of this study: sample size, sampling methodology, and the time of year for data collection. Summer recreational use is relatively low for this area, and data collection between late June and early August 2014 yielded 74 surveys. Segmentation of the data was not performed as the sample size was too small to yield meaningful results

(VanVoorhis & Morgan 2007).

A second limitation of this study regarded sampling methodology. Convenience sampling was employed in order to collect as many surveys as possible. Recreation data collected through convenience sampling are not as valid as probability sampling methods (Watson, Cole, Turner,

& Reynolds, 2000). However, because recreational use during the sampling timeframe was very low, a strict systematic sampling schedule would have yielded much fewer data. As a result, higher use areas were sampled more frequently than the rarely used sites. 9

The third limitation was the time of year for data collection. Summer use is low compared to the use that takes place during peak hunting seasons, and it is also different. As discussed, a myriad of recreational opportunities are provided by this area of the Forest, and an adequate representation cannot be captured by this narrow sampling timeframe.

Definitions

Appropriate Use. Use that is “in accordance with management direction” (Haas, 2002).

Management direction may include federal, state, or other legislation and/or regulations.

Outstandingly Remarkable Values (ORVs). "A unique, rare, or exemplary feature that is significant at a comparative regional or national scale” (USDA, 2015). According to the Wild and Scenic Rivers Act, ORVs can be related to scenery, recreation, geology, fish and wildlife, history, culture, or other similar values (section 1(b)), and administration of a Wild and Scenic

River must “protect and enhance” these values (section 10(a)).

Recreational Segment. For Wild and Scenic rivers, “sections of rivers that are readily accessible by road or railroad, that may have some development along their shorelines, and that may have undergone some impoundment or diversion in the past” (Wild and Scenic Rivers Act, section 2(b)).

Scenic Segment. For Wild and Scenic rivers, “sections of rivers that are free of impoundments, with shorelines or watersheds still largely primitive and shorelines largely undeveloped, but accessible in places by roads” (Wild and Scenic Rivers Act, section 2(b)).

Social Carrying Capacity. “the level of recreational use an area can withstand while providing a sustained quality of recreation” (Wagar, 1964).

Sound Professional Judgement. “A reasonable decision that has been given full and fair consideration to all the appropriate information, that is based upon principled and reasoned 10 analysis and the best available science and expertise, and that complies with applicable laws”

(Haas, 2002).

Visitor Capacity. “the supply, or prescribed number, of appropriate visitor opportunities that will be accommodated in an area” (Haas, 2002). More general than the social carrying capacity concept, visitor capacity is concerned with management of natural and cultural resources in addition to recreational experiences.

Wild and Scenic River. A river which is protected by the Wild and Scenic Rivers Act of

1968. This Act grants administrative authority for river management to specific public land management units.

Wild segment. For Wild and Scenic rivers, “sections of rivers that are free of impoundments and generally inaccessible except by , with watersheds or shorelines essentially primitive and waters unpolluted” (Wild and Scenic Rivers Act, section 2(b)).

Wilderness. Federal lands which are protected by the Wilderness Act of 1964. The Act calls for Wilderness areas to be “protected and managed so as to preserve its natural conditions” and to also provide “outstanding opportunities for solitude or a primitive and unconfined type of recreation” (Wilderness Act, section 2(c)).

Social carrying capacity

Public land managers must determine what recreational uses and use levels are appropriate for the areas they manage. Social carrying capacity is a concept that was developed to aid in this process. Carrying capacity is a term originally used within the context of ecology in reference to questions regarding how many individuals that a defined space is able to sustain healthfully. Wagar (1964, 1974) formalized the concept of social carrying capacity (first described with the less precise term recreational carrying capacity in 1964), defining it as “the 12 level of recreational use an area can withstand while providing a sustained quality of recreation”

(1964, p 3). Wagar’s approach considers the perceptible impacts on the physical environment, but extends it to include the quality of human experience that can also be affected by increased recreational use. Wagar (1964, 1974), Lime and Stankey (1971), and others offer methods for managing for this “sustained quality,” suggesting solutions such as zoning for different types of recreation, or interpretive techniques that can help visitors comply with regulations, keeping in mind that the complex values involved and management decisions employed are ultimately matters of human judgment. The more commonly used frameworks to assess social carrying capacity and define appropriate use and use levels include Visitor Experience and Resource

Protection (VERP) (National Park Service, 1997); Visitor Impact Management (VIM) (Graefe,

Kuss, and Vaske, 1990); Limits of Acceptable Change (LAC) (Stankey, Cole, Lucas, Petersen, &

Frissell, 1985); and the Recreational Opportunity Spectrum (ROS) (Clark & Stankey, 1979;

Driver & Brown, 1978). Both the LAC and ROS frameworks were heavily developed by and utilized within the Forest Service and are discussed here.

The Limits of Acceptable Change (LAC) is a nine-step process developed for the management of Wilderness recreational opportunities though it has proven useful when applied outside of Wilderness contexts (Cole & McCool, 1997). The process is naturally rooted in the concept of social carrying capacity (Stankey et al., 1985). However, LAC restates social carrying capacity’s central question, refining the ambiguous inquiry of “how much [use] is too much?” and instead asking “how much change is acceptable?” (Stankey, McCool, & Stokes,

1984).Whether or not an action is considered “acceptable” is ultimately a value judgment (1984), and this subjectivity is inescapable when managing carrying capacity (Wagar, 1964). However, 13 the LAC process incorporates public input, thereby allowing for multiple perspectives about how areas should be managed (Stankey et al., 1985).

The Recreational Opportunity Spectrum (ROS) is another tool that is part of the LAC process and helps managers serve the diverse needs and tastes of the public. ROS is a framework developed in the 1970s by the Forest Service, and it has been applied by many agencies in many countries. It is based on the premise that outdoor recreation quality is most likely to exist if managers provide different types of opportunities for recreation to reflect the diversity of visitor preferences (Clark and Stankey, 1979; Driver & Brown, 1978). The framework gives managers specific criteria such as “remoteness” or “evidence of humans” by which to classify an activity, setting, or experience. The traditional model includes six classifications, ranging from

“primitive” to “urban” (USDA, 1982). ROS is a mapping tool that has been appropriated in different ways. Pierskalla, Siniscalchi, Selin, and Fosbender (2007) added the dimension of movement in an ROS study, recognizing that recreation takes place in space and time and cannot necessarily be confined to “static” ROS zones (2007). Using the ROS framework helps the

Forest Service meet legislative requirements, including the management of Wild and Scenic

Rivers (Clark and Stankey, 1979).

Wagar (1964) pointed out that while the empirical evidence provided by social carrying capacity research is certainly useful for guidance, at the end of the day someone must make the final decisions. The Federal Interagency Task Force on Visitor Capacity on Public Lands (Haas,

2002) has provided practical tools specifically designed for making decisions about visitor capacity. Visitor capacity is different from (but inclusive of) social carrying capacity, as it is concerned with not just visitor experience but also with visitor impacts on resources. One tool 14 suggested by the task force is an “appropriate use protocol” which was adapted for this study and will be described in Chapter 3.

Crowding

Crowding is a concept that grew out of the more broad scholarship involving social carrying capacity. Concepts such as crowding are taken on with a “normative approach,” based on the Return Potential Model of social norms (Jackson, 1965). Much of the empirical foundation for setting appropriate use levels rests on this approach which asks visitors to define what is acceptable (Cole, 2001). Degrees of crowding can be assessed using Likert-type scales, first developed in the field of psychology (Likert, 1932) and often used in surveys to assess levels of satisfaction or agreement with a statement. Using graded scales can be more helpful for understanding what visitors perceive as acceptable, as opposed to asking dichotomous yes or no questions (Shelby & Heberlein, 1986).

Heberlein and Vaske (1977) developed the most popular scale to date for measuring crowding in recreation research, rating the concept from 1 (not at all crowded) to 9 (extremely crowded). Degrees of crowding can vary dependent upon the variable examined. Vaske and

Shelby (2008) analyzed 181 studies conducted over 30 years which used the traditional 9-point scale, finding significant differences dependent upon type of activity, region of the U.S., and country (including , New Zealand and the U.S.). “Crowding” is not a universal concept nor does it translate into some other languages. Also, this concept may be more relevant for outdoor recreation research in the U.S., which generally takes a more anthropocentric approach to recreation management compared to other countries with a more ecocentric approach (Burns

& Moreira, 2013; Ruschkowski, Burns, Arnberger, Smaldone, & Meybin, 2013). 15

The 9-point scale attempts to assess perceived crowding, which is used in outdoor recreation research to denote a “negative evaluation of density” (Shelby & Heberlein, 1986, p.

63). Both outside of and within the U.S., this negative implication is not always appropriate. For example, Heberlein and Kuentzel (2002) found that hunters might prefer a certain number of other hunters nearby to move game toward them. Giglioti and Chase (2014) used a scale ranging from “not enough hunters” to “very crowded,” to address this. Bivalent scales such as these at times may be more appropriate for assessing the correlation between satisfaction and the number of people seen.

Conflict

Outdoor recreation researchers examine conflict both within and between user groups.

Satisfaction can be affected when visitors encounter other groups participating in an activity that they do not perceive as appropriate, even if the activity encountered is appropriate according to other recreationists, managers, and policy and legislation (Stankey 1973). For example, Lucas’

(1964) Boundary Waters study found that paddling canoeists are bothered by motorboatists.

Hikers can be bothered by horseback riders (Stankey, 1973), and skiers can be negatively impacted by snowmobilers (Jackson & Wong, 1982). In all three cases, the latter groups were not bothered by the former. Also in all three cases, the former groups were not as bothered by encountering other groups that were like them (other canoeists, hikers, and skiers).

Satisfaction

Satisfaction is a complex concept that is difficult to measure, but measures of satisfaction are traditionally how researchers determine recreation quality (Manning, 2011).

Items that can affect visitor satisfaction when recreating vary broadly, from campsite conditions to perceptions of crowding. When outdoor recreation researchers attempt quantitative 16 measurement of satisfaction, they often utilize tools developed within the field of consumer marketing research. Parasuraman, Zeithaml, and Berry (1985; 1988) developed the SERVQUAL model to examine satisfaction among consumers by measuring quality. They define perceived service quality as the “degree and direction of discrepancy between consumers’ perceptions and expectations” (1988, pp. 16-17). This model focuses on the (intangible) service quality as opposed to (tangible) product quality. This naturally extends to the outdoor recreation field, where recreation (and the services that provide recreational opportunities) are often intangible products. The model has been tailored for quantitative analysis of recreation satisfaction (Burns,

Graefe, & Absher 2003; Crompton, MacKay, & Fesenmaier, 1991; Graefe & Burns, 2013).

Motivation

While research on motivation dates to more general leisure research of the 1920s, Driver and associates began developing the concepts and measurement tools most specific to outdoor recreation beginning in the 1970s (Driver & Toucher, 1970 and others). Expectancy theory provides the theoretical foundation for much of the research, focusing on the idea that people are motivated to perform a behavior because they expect this to lead to desired psychological outcomes (Lawler, 1973). To measure motivations in outdoor recreation, researchers often adapt

Driver’s (1983) Recreation Experience Preference (REP) scales. In a meta-analysis of 36 studies utilizing REP scale items, Manfredo, Driver and Tarrant (1996) grouped individual motivational scale items (such as “to view the scenic beauty”) into broader domains (such as “enjoy nature”).

Many studies have utilized this approach in order to understand more general goals of recreationists (Manning, 2011).

Outdoor Recreationists and Recreation in the U.S.

The Outdoor Recreation Research Review Commission (ORRRC) was created by

Congress in 1958 as a response to the postwar increase in outdoor recreation in the U.S. Though only in existence for four years, it helped create a permanent space for outdoor recreation research in the U.S., and it was a catalyst for many other programs and projects (Siehl, 2008).

One of these programs was the National Survey on Recreation and the Environment (NSRE), a survey series begun in 1960. The Forest Service administers this today, collecting data about outdoor recreationists throughout the country (USDA, 2013a).

In 1993, the Executive Order “Setting Customer Service Standards” was put forth to ensure that federal agencies provide “the highest quality service possible to the American people” leading to the Forest Service’s development of the National Visitor Use Monitoring

Program (NVUM) (USDA, 2012). This standardized process is conducted every five years for each Forest, and provides quantitative data about recreationists and their activities (English,

Kocis, Zarnoch, & Arnold, 2002). In the most recent NVUM Visitor Use Report for the fiscal year (FY) 2009 (USDA, 2012) for the Umatilla NF, at least 80.7% of recreationists interviewed were recreating on the forest.

Recreationists

Recreation research has suggested certain correlations between sociodemographic characteristics and recreational use. While income and level of education are not always strong indicators for outdoor recreation participation overall, both are positively correlated with specific recreational activities (Manning 2011; Bowker, Cordell, & Green, 2012). Women and ethnic and racial minorities are disproportionally absent from the data, especially when Wilderness areas are studied (Bowker et al., 2006 and others). This has sparked much research in the discipline to 18 examine what constraints these underrepresented groups may be facing and what preferences they may have when recreating. For example, several studies have shown that Asian American and Hispanic groups prefer to recreate in larger groups involving family (Burns, Covelli, &

Graefe, 2008; Chavez, 2001). In a focus group study about ethnic and racial minority recreationists in Oregon, Burns et al. (2008) found that sought solitude as a benefit of recreation. This is a value often associated with Wilderness, but this study and others

(Bowker et al., 2006; Tierney, Dahl, & Chavez, 1998) have concluded that African-American groups are less likely to visit remote areas, including Wilderness.

NVUM (USDA, 2012) Forest-wide data collected in 2009 for the Umatilla NF shows that more visitors were male (66.6%), the vast majority of visitors were Caucasian (99.0%), and only a small percentage (1.2%) identified as Hispanic. Over one-third (39.6%) were 20-49 years of age, and over half (62.8%) earned between 25k and 100k per year.

Wilderness Recreationists

Generally, Wilderness users are likely to be Caucasian, male, young to middle-aged, and possess higher incomes and especially education levels (Manning 2011; Bowker, Cordell, and

Green, 2012), though not all studies have found higher income (Lucas, 1980) or education

(Bowker et al., 2006) to characterize visitors. Several studies comparing multiple

(Bowker et al., 2006; Cole & Hall, 2008; Lucas, 1980; Stankey, 1973) have revealed patterns about Wilderness users and preferences. Visiting groups are typically small (Cole & Hall, 2008;

Lucas, 1980). Visits are more likely to be day trips (Cole & Hall, 2008; Lucas, 1980) though

Lucas (1980) found the size of the area to correlate with length of stay.

Wilderness recreation studies often focus on the concepts of crowding and conflict, because Wilderness visitors tend to strongly value solitude and encountering other groups often 19 affect their trip enjoyment (Lucas, 1980; Stankey, 1973). Wilderness visitors usually would rather not encounter other groups (Lucas, 1980; Stankey, 1973). Often the type of group encountered is more important to visitors than the encounter itself. Stankey (1973) found that visitors’ feelings about an encounter were related to the size and behavior of the group they encountered. The mode of travel was also important; hikers were bothered by horseback trail riders and paddling canoeists were bothered by motorboats.

Visitors to Wilderness areas often share preferences with one another and with recreationists in general. Wilderness users who camp prefer a campsite close to water

(Christensen & Cole, 2000; Stankey, 1973), a characteristic shared with non-Wilderness users

(Cordell & Sykes 1969; Lime, 1971). Campfires are also important to Wilderness and backcountry users (Christensen & Cole, 2000; Vagias, Powell, Moore, & Wright, 2014) as well as non-Wilderness users (Lillywhite, Simensen, & Fowler, 2013). Recreationists in Wilderness have been responsive to management transitions away from fire rings and toward cook stoves in many areas (Christensen & Cole, 2000). However, they will often build a campfire if given the opportunity and Manning (2011) cites many studies showing that Wilderness users object to the idea of campfire prohibitions.

NVUM data for Wilderness areas on the Umatilla NF are limited as sample sizes were small during the last two rounds (2004: n=8; 2009: n=26). For 2009, Wilderness visitors were more likely to be male (93.9%) and 51% were between 20 and 49 years of age.

Recreational Use

Outdoor recreationists enjoy many different activities dependent upon personal interest and opportunities provided. According to NSRE data, the most popular outdoor recreation activities in the U.S. between 2005 – 2009 were sightseeing (52.7%), picnicking (51.7%), and 20 visiting historic sites (44.1%) as shown in Table 1 which compares selected national and state

(OR) recreational activities. It omits some popular activities if they were irrelevant (e.g. swimming in an outdoor pool). According to recent data collected in 2011 for Oregon’s

Statewide Comprehensive Outdoor Recreation Plan (SCORP), Oregonians reflect some nationwide trends; some of the top activities reported in 2011 included sightseeing (57.5%) and picnicking (49.7%). But in some ways, Oregon residents differ from national patterns. They are more likely to day hike, participate in developed camping, and backpack. They are less likely to fish.

Projections for the Future

Passel and Cohn (2008) have projected that by the year 2050 (compared to 2005), 29% of the

U.S. population will be Hispanic, an increase from 14%. Adults 65 years of age and older will rise from 12% to 19% of the population. The White (non-Hispanic) population will drop from

67% to 47%. As previously discussed, the “traditional” recreationist profile has been that of 22

Caucasians with higher incomes and educational backgrounds, who are often younger to middle- aged. The sociodemographic shifts on the horizon have inspired research so that managers can provide recreational opportunities for underserved groups, and also continue to garner public support for public lands in general.

Bowker and Askew (2012) have made nationwide projections about recreational activities through 2060. Because population numbers will increase, this could put pressure on certain areas with limited recreational opportunities. If climate change patterns continue as expected, snow sports could be affected, as well as hunting and angling opportunities when fish and wildlife habitats change. Regardless of climate change, they conclude that participation in hunting and fishing will continue to decline. For activities most relevant to backcountry and

Wilderness areas, there will be increases in horseback riding, challenge-related activities, and day hiking. Bowker and Askew (2012) projected that visits to primitive areas will decline overall, but English and Bowker (2015) have stated that population growth near Wilderness areas will lead to more visits in those areas. In addition, they expect day use to continue to increase compared to overnight use.

In conclusion of this section about recreationists and the activities they pursue, it is important to make one last point. It is noted throughout the literature that profiling recreationists can lead to the perpetuation of stereotypes and misconceptions of user groups. Shafer’s 1969 study The Average Camper Who Doesn’t Exist illustrated this quite clearly. The characteristics, preferences, and use patterns of recreationists are incredibly complex and generalities can be misleading. That being said, outdoor recreation research strives for better understanding in its analysis of sociodemographic data and patterns of use, with the end goal to better serve the 23 public, and better protect resources. Primary Documents: Federal Legislation

The Wilderness Act. The Endangered American Wilderness Act of 1978 established the federal status of the Wenaha-Tucannon. However, it is the Wilderness Act of 1964 that guides the management for all Wilderness areas in the U.S. The Wilderness Act created a definition for

Wilderness and outlined the terms of how Wilderness should be designated and managed. The brevity of the document leaves many unanswered questions about how exactly managers should carry out the terms of the Act. Hendee, Stankey and Lucas (1978) point out that initially

“wilderness management” was approached with the idea: “draw a line around it and leave it alone,” and that any further action was often confusing to the public. However, management that involves Wilderness does not seek to control natural processes that occur, but rather the human use of that Wilderness (p. 6). Each of the four land management agencies which manage

Wilderness (the Bureau of Land Management, National Park Service, Forest Service, and U.S.

Fish and Wildlife Service) have developed their own agency policies which provide direction.

For the Forest Service, agency directives such as the Forest Service Manual (USDA, 1997) and

Forest Service Handbooks (USDA, 2000a) provide guidance for Wilderness management. The

Forest Service manages the most Wilderness units (439) in the U.S., and is second only to the

National Park Service in acres managed totaling over 36 million (USDA, 2014). Much of the development of monitoring methods that help administrators manage recreation in Wilderness stems from the work of Cole (1983, 1989), among others.

The Interagency Wilderness Character Monitoring Team (IWCMT) was created to develop a strategy to help standardize a definition for qualities of “wilderness character” and provide indicators and measures for these qualities (Landres et al., 2005; 2008). Interagency teams and task forces are helpful in public land management because they develop common 25 language, methods, and standards across different agencies sharing the same objectives. The

IWCMT defined four qualities of Wilderness character in 2005. These four qualities summarize

Section 2(c) of the Wilderness Act, and define Wilderness as:

 Untrammeled – wilderness is essentially unhindered and free from modern human

control or manipulation.

 Natural – wilderness ecological systems are substantially free from the effects of

modern civilization.

 Undeveloped – wilderness is essentially without permanent improvements or

modern human occupation.

 Outstanding opportunities for solitude or a primitive and unconfined type of

recreation – Wilderness provides outstanding opportunities for people to experience

solitude or primitive and unconfined recreation, including the values of inspiration

and physical and mental challenge. (Landres et al., 2005).

Many initiatives and programs have been developed in order to protect these Wilderness qualities. The Aldo Leopold Wilderness Research Institute and the Arthur Carhart Wilderness

Training Center have been instrumental in recent years in training and educating Wilderness managers and disseminating information to the public.

The Wild and Scenic Rivers Act. The 1988, the Oregon Omnibus National Wild and

Scenic Rivers Act designated the Wenaha as a Wild and Scenic River, but managers rely on the

Wild and Scenic Rivers Act of 1968 (the Act) to guide action in protecting river values. The Act specifies that a Wild and Scenic River is to be designated by Congress, should be “preserved in free-flowing condition,” and that its immediate environment contains one or more “outstandingly remarkable values (ORVs)” pertaining to scenic, recreational, geologic, fish and wildlife, 26 historic, cultural, or other similar values (Sections 1 and 2). Throughout the designation process of a particular river, several responsibilities are given to federal agencies. The agency deemed responsible for the river conducts studies to determine if the river contains ORVs and if so, which ones (section 4(a)). The agency establishes boundaries for the river corridor per guidelines outlined in the Act (section 3(b)), and determines how each section of the river should be classified: wild, scenic, or recreational (section 3 (b)). The definitions for each section are listed here:

 Wild river areas - Those rivers or sections of rivers that are free of impoundments

and generally inaccessible except by trail, with watersheds or shorelines essentially

primitive and waters unpolluted. These represent vestiges of primitive America.

 Scenic river areas - Those rivers or sections of rivers that are free of impoundments,

with shorelines or watersheds still largely primitive and shorelines largely undeveloped,

but accessible in places by roads.

 Recreational river areas - Those rivers or sections of rivers that are readily

accessible by road or railroad, that may have some development along their shorelines,

and that may have undergone some impoundment or diversion in the past” (Wild and

Scenic Rivers Act, section 2(b)).

When a river is designated, the responsible agency or agencies will develop a

Comprehensive River Management Plan (CRMP) (section 3(d)). The Act states that designated rivers shall be “administered in such a manner as to protect and enhance the values which caused it to be included…” (section 10 (a)). Yet, like the Wilderness Act, it gives great freedom to federal agencies in how exactly they carry this out. It is expected that each will apply its own 27 agency policies and best judgment. Agency directives and other planning documents enable

CRMP development.

The Act also states that the CRMP should be developed within three years of the time of designation (section 3(d)(1)). The Wenaha was designated in 1988; the CRMP was implemented in 2015. A Forest Service employee and representative for the Interagency Wild and Scenic

River Coordinating Council was contacted to find out if this was common. His response was as follows:

The 3 year date for CRMP’s (sic) has always been a strawman. A goal worth

shooting for but generally unrealistic given the amount of work and the vagaries of

federal funding and priorities. Agencies try to do their best to meet it, but since Congress

has not done any extensive follow-up on late CRMP’s they often take much longer. It

takes agency champions and external interests to combine to help bring these plans to

completion (personal communication, January 13, 2015).

In 1993, the Interagency Wild and Scenic River Coordinating Council was created and is comparable to the Wilderness interagency councils in that it seeks to develop strategies for all public land managers to carry out the terms of federal legislation. The River Management

Society currently works with federal agencies in the development of the National River

Recreation Database, designed to provide information such as recreational access points, regulations and restrictions, and fees (River Management Society, 2015).

The National Environmental Policy Act. Since the late 1960s, agencies often find themselves under the scrutiny of an increasingly aware and involved citizenry. The National

Environmental Policy Act of 1969 (NEPA) requires all federal agencies to report the potential environmental impact of a “proposed action” that is planned, along with “alternative actions” 28

(National Environmental Policy Act Title I section 102 (C)). They are also required to make this information available for the public’s review and comment, and to consider public comments before the implementation of a final decision. This legislation came about during what Leong,

Decker, Lauber, Raik, and Siemer (2009) identified as a legislative shift from “top-down governance” to “public input governance.” A third shift toward “public engagement governance” has occurred with the Federal Advisory Committee Act of 1972 and the Negotiated Rulemaking

Act of 1996 (Leong et al., 2009). This era is defined by more collaborative processes in rulemaking as it “emphasizes dialogue and mutual learning between agencies and multiple stakeholders to identify common interests, broaden the decision space, and develop sustainable alternatives” (Leong, Emmerson, & Byron, 2011).

Before a new management action can be implemented on public land, either an

Environmental Assessment (EA) or the more complex Environmental Impact Statement (EIS) must be conducted in accordance with NEPA. Two of these documents important for this thesis are the Wenaha Wild and Scenic River CRMP (EA) (2015) and the Blue Mountains National

Forests Revised Land Management Plan (EIS) (2014) which are discussed in the next section.

Secondary Documents: Forest Service

The Forest Service is tasked with developing the Comprehensive River Management Plan

(CRMP) for the Wenaha Wild and Scenic River (Omnibus Act section 102). The agency is also required to cooperate with other agencies and parties which are involved with the river, but the

Forest Service is not allowed to exercise authority outside of Forest boundaries. A multitude of documents are utilized by the Umatilla NF in support of the goal of upholding legislation that guides the management of both the Wenaha Wild and Scenic River (river) and the Wenaha-

Tucannon Wilderness (Wilderness). The Forest Service uses agency directives and existing plans 29 to manage the wild section of the river which exists within its boundaries, and collaborates with other parties and their resources with regard to the scenic and recreational river sections.

Agency Directives.The Forest Service has two primary directives: the Forest Service

Manual (FSM) (USDA, 1997) and Forest Service Handbooks (FSH) (USDA, 2000a). The FSM provides more general guidance regarding legislation, policy and procedures for line officers and staff; FSH gives specific direction on how to execute objectives and is utilized primarily by technicians and specialists (USDA, 2000b). The FSM and FSH help guide all Forest Service activities, such as managing public participation during the NEPA process, executing a Forest plan revision, and managing Wilderness and Wild and Scenic Rivers.

Wenaha Comprehensive River Management Plan (CRMP). The Forest Service conducted a resource assessment in 1992 which determined that the river exhibits four outstandingly remarkable values (ORVs): scenery, recreation, wildlife, and fisheries (USDA,

1992). Earlier studies had determined the appropriate wild, scenic, and recreational section classifications. The CRMP presents two alternatives: Alternative A (No Action) and the

Proposed Action. The Proposed Action describes what the Umatilla recommends be included in the CRMP for river management. Like all EAs, these recommendations were available to be reviewed and commented upon by the public. Much of the supporting data and documentation for the development of the CRMP are from the Wenaha Wild and Scenic River Capacity

Analysis conducted in 2011 (USDA, 2013).

The purpose for the capacity analysis (completed in 2013) was to analyze visitor capacity for the river in support of the development of the CRMP. It proposed the desired conditions for each of the four ORVs. It also named consistent and inconsistent uses that could have an effect on the ORVs in terms of visitor capacity. These uses include both visitor activities and Forest 30

Service administrative activities. The capacity analysis defines inconsistent (or “inappropriate”) use as “either occurring or potential threats to ORVs that could limit capacity by requiring additional regulations and limitations” (USDA 2013b, p. 14). Consistent (or “appropriate”) uses, alternatively, are “uses and activities that are consistent with protection of … [an] ORV” (p. 8).

The inconsistent uses, along with specific management indicators (number of vehicles at trailheads, number and condition of semi-primitive campsites, and group size) were discussed in the capacity analysis and helped guide the study design for this thesis.

Wenaha-Tucannon Wilderness Management Plan. The Wenaha-Tucannon Wilderness was designated as such in 1978. The 1989 Wilderness Plan provides specific direction for the management of this area, and was used as a supporting document for the development of the

Blue Mountains National Forests Proposed Revised Land Management Plan.

Blue Mountains National Forests Proposed Revised Land Management Plan. The

National Forest Management Act (NFMA) (1976) requires that each National Forest develop and operate based on its own land management plan. The Blue Mountains National Forests Proposed

Revised Land Management Plan (Revised Forest Plan) (2014) has been under development since

2004 as a joint effort between the Umatilla, Wallowa-Whitman, and Malheur National Forests.

All respective Forest plans were approved in 1990, and all were in need of revision according to the NFMA. The Umatilla Forest Plan (USDA, 1990) was one of the supporting documents for the revised plan that would replace it.

The complexities involved in the Forest Plan Revision required an EIS. It presents six alternatives: Alternative A (No Action) and Alternatives B, C, D, E, and F. In 2010, a revised plan was proposed that was most similar to Alternative B. However, during the public review process, the public expressed concerns with the plan, and six themes arose from these concerns. 31

The 2010 proposed revision was determined unsuitable as it did not adequately address the public’s concerns. As a result, the Forest Plan Revision Team developed all of the alternatives, and each address these six themes in various ways. Alternative E was been named the “Preferred

Alternative” by the Forest Service (USDA, 2014).

A major part of the Revised Forest Plan is the addition of standards, guidelines, and other components to direct management on each Forest. There are hosts of proposed components, representing nearly one-quarter of a century of the changing needs of three Forests. One outcome of the implementation of this plan will be the recommendation of the addition of 8,880 acres of

Wilderness north of the study area. Further, the north and south forks of the Wenaha have been determined as eligible for addition to the Wild and Scenic Rivers system. These areas which are adjacent to the study area for this thesis will be protected by the Revised Plan pending designation. The CRMP for the Wenaha will amend the Revised Forest Plan.

Tertiary Documents: Bureau of Land Management, State, and County.

Bureau of Land Management (BLM). The BLM is involved with administration of several different areas of the Wenaha’s scenic and recreational river sections. The north side of the scenic section of the corridor includes a small parcel of land which was identified as an Area of Critical Environmental Concern (ACEC) and is managed by the BLM. Some of the areas of the south side of the scenic section of the corridor were put under the authority of the

Department of Energy in 1920 with the Federal Power Act, but have been managed by BLM since 1966 (Wallowa and Grande Ronde Rivers Management Plan, 1993 p. 5). Finally, just as the Forest Service is the administrative authority for the Wenaha, the BLM is the authority for the Grande Ronde Wild and Scenic River, and the corridors of these rivers overlap. The entire

Wenaha recreational section (0.15 mile) and a small portion of its scenic section (0.10 mile) falls 32 within the corridor. When the Wallowa and Grande Ronde Rivers

Management Plan was completed in 1993, it included the recreational section of the Wenaha because the Wenaha CRMP had not undergone development yet and because “that sector of the

Wenaha has the same issues and concerns common to the Grande Ronde corridor” (1993, p. 2-3).

The BLM administers these areas utilizing this and the Baker Resource Management Plan

(RMP) (BLM, 2011). Development for the Revised RMP was on hold during the time this thesis was written as planning for the Greater Sage Grouse, a candidate species for listing, took precedence. The 2011 Draft Revised RMP was used for this thesis.

State of Oregon. Several state governing bodies have an interest in the study area and work with other agencies and citizens to manage it. For example, Oregon’s Department of

Forestry and the Forest Service share and enforce Public Use Restrictions each fire season (ODF,

2015; USDA, 2013a). The state authority most intricately involved with the study area is the

Oregon Department of Fish and Wildlife (ODFW). As is typical for state agencies, the ODFW regulates all hunting and fishing for the state of Oregon, working closely with the U.S. Fish and

Wildlife Service in the interest of sustainable habitat management with special attention to endangered and threatened species. The ODFW is responsible for management of the Wenaha

Wildlife Area, a checkerboard of lands which includes portions of the wild, scenic, and recreational sections of the Wenaha river corridor. These lands include the Mill Bar

Campground (also known as “Griz Flatts”) on the south side of the scenic and recreation sections of the corridor, and it is used frequently for its campsites and by the Troy Muzzleloaders shooting club. The ODFW’s Wenaha Wildlife Area Management Plan provides management direction for the area’s 12,419 acres, along with an additional bordering 1,329 acres of BLM lands (2007, p. 3). This 2007 plan is scheduled to be updated in 2017. It prioritizes management 33 for wildlife habitat diversity, conflicts between landowners and elk and deer, and wildlife-related recreational an educational opportunities for the public (2007, pp. 2-3).

Oregon’s state lands obtain management guidance from Oregon Administrative Rules

(OARs) put forth by the Oregon Parks and Recreation Department (OSOS, 2015). OAR 736-

040-0047 applies specifically to the Grande Ronde River, because it is a Scenic Waterway protected by the state of Oregon in addition to its status as a federally designated Wild and

Scenic River. This OAR also applies to a portion of the Wenaha because the two corridors overlap (even though the Wenaha is not designated as a Scenic waterway). The rule contains a section (section 4) dedicated to the Troy River Community Area. The majority of this section pertains to new development guidelines for the area. Specific rules for public use, including recreational use, are provided by another section (section 5).

Wallowa County. The Wallowa County Comprehensive Land Use Plan (2005) provides direction about appropriate land use in Wallowa County, which includes the of Troy. Two articles in the plan pertain to general recreation allowances, and one article provides direction that is specific for Troy.

Study Area

The Wenaha Wild and Scenic River runs east from the Blue Mountains. The federally protected portion is 21.6 miles long, and begins in Wilderness at the confluence of the north and south forks of the river. Its corridor includes land managed by the U.S. Forest Service, BLM, state of Oregon, and private landowners and business owners. The river terminates in the town of

Troy as it meets the Grande Ronde River (Figure 1).

The study area was divided into five smaller subunits for analysis: the wild section of the river corridor (in Wilderness), the wild section of the corridor (not in Wilderness), the scenic and recreational corridor sections, and non-corridor areas. All are described below.

Wild River Section (Wilderness)

The majority (15.2 miles) of the wild section’s 18.7 miles runs through the Wenaha-

Tucannon Wilderness (Wilderness) (Figure 2). This entire portion is within Forest boundaries.

Four of the six trailheads sampled for this study provide direct access to this segment; they are the Cross , Hoodoo, Elk Flat, and Three Forks trailheads. These are located just outside of the Wilderness boundaries and provide limited parking and facilities. Visitors leave these areas on foot or on horseback and descend as much as 3,000 feet to the river. All reach the 35

Figure 1. The Study Area. Map courtesy of the Umatilla National Forest (USDA, 2015).

river within five miles, except for the Three Forks Trail which is 22.4 miles north of the river.

Each trail contains a number of switchbacks and various levels of exposure. Upon reaching the river, visitors can follow the Wenaha River Trail, which runs 31.3 miles from the town of Troy to the Timothy Springs trailhead. The Wenaha River Trail runs along the north side of the river, but can still be accessed from the south simply by crossing the river. While there are no bridges, the water is low enough much of the year to cross in many places.

36

Figure 2. Google Earth Image of a Portion of the Wild Corridor Segment. A view downriver from the “Wenaha Forks” area, where the wild section begins in the Wenaha-Tucannon Wilderness. Source: Google Inc. (2015).

Wild River Section (non-Wilderness)

The remainder of the wild section (3.5 miles) is outside of Wilderness, but still within

Forest Service boundaries. It is most directly accessed by the Troy trailhead. This non-

Wilderness area is similar in character to the wild river section within Wilderness.

Scenic River Section

The 2.7 mile scenic section (Figure 3) is outside of Wilderness and outside of Forest boundaries. There are BLM, state, and private land in this part of the corridor. Much of this section is remote, providing opportunities for solitude similar to those provided by the wild section. From the north, the scenic section of the river is most easily accessed from the Troy TH.

From here, visitors can travel on foot or horseback on the Wenaha River Trail which intercepts the scenic section and continues into the wild section. On the south side of the river, a portion of the scenic section is easily accessed and utilized frequently by recreationists camping on state 37 lands. Car camping is common in this area, which is a short walking distance from the center of the town of Troy. This area is also utilized frequently used by the Wenaha Muzzleloaders Club for target practice and competitions.

Figure 3. A Semi-Primitive Campsite on the Scenic Section. Much of this section of the Wenaha is remote and offers recreational opportunities comparable to the wild river section.

Recreational River Section

This small 0.15-mile section (Figure 4) joins the Grande Ronde and exists within the town of Troy. Though summer months can be quiet in Troy compared to hunting and steelhead fishing seasons, this is a popular take-out location for rafters floating the Grande Ronde. On the south side of the river, state-managed campsites extend into the recreational section of the corridor. On the north side, the Shilo Troy Resort is a privately-owned business which provides 38 developed camping opportunities on the recreation section of the river. Seven of these twenty developed campsites available are located on the Wenaha. (The remaining 13 are on the Grande

Ronde.) In addition, several rental cabins and a few private homes are located within the .25 miles of the river corridor boundary and on adjacent lands. At the time of data collection, eight individuals lived year-round in the town of Troy, and utilized the corridor in their daily lives.

The Shilo Troy Resort also leases land in Troy to hunters who come every fall. These hunters pay monthly rent to leave their wall up year-round in this convenient location that accesses the Wenaha Hunt Unit and provides big game processing equipment.

Figure 4. Google Earth View from the Troy Trailhead. The town of Troy is shown with a a portion of the Wenaha’s recreational section (pictured right) before it flows into the Grand Ronde (pictured left). Visitors can cross the bridge to the State campground directly across the Wenaha from Troy or climb FS Road 62 to more remote access points such as the Hoodoo, Cross Canyon, and Elk Flat trailheads.

Data Collection

Quantitative data collected for this thesis included data obtained through surveys and vehicle counts. Ocular data was recorded in the field to supplement the discussion of these quantitative data. Details about data collection are described in this section. Details about data analysis will be discussed in the next section.

Recreation Surveys

Instrumentation. The survey instrument (Appendix A) was five pages long and included quantitative items pertaining to sociodemographics, group characteristics, trip characteristics, activity participation, satisfaction, motivations, and crowding/conflict.

Sociodemographic items included gender, age, education, income, racial and ethnic group identification, and . Local/non-local status was assessed by defining local visitors as those with a home zip code with a centroid within a 100-mile radius of the coordinates of the most central survey site location, which was the Cross Canyon Trailhead (Chang & Burns, 2012;

English et al., 2002). A 100-mile radius was chosen rather than the more typical 50-mile radius because of the rural nature of this part of the ; very few were within 50 miles of the centroid of the study area. Group characteristics included group type (private or commercial), and the number of adults and children in the group. Trip characteristics included whether this was a first or repeat visit, year of first visit, number of days spent here or other

Wildernesses or Wild and Scenic Rivers, whether this visit was a day trip or overnight visit, time 40 spent trip planning, primary destination, and length of stay. Visitors were also asked where they started their trip, where they parked their vehicle(s), and how many vehicles were in their group.

The final three items in this category included whether or not the visitor recreated on Forest lands, the river corridor section(s) within which the visitor recreated, and where applicable, the location of the visitor’s campsite. For these last three items, a modified version of the Pomeroy

Ranger District Forest map was created in order to communicate with the visitor about exactly where they recreated. The map showed Forest/non-Forest lands, the three river corridor sections

(wild, scenic, and recreational), and seventeen camp “zones.” Zones were created after consulting Forest managers and staff about how zones should be defined in order to be meaningful to managers. Zone boundaries were logically created by utilizing natural features

(such creek with the river) and important distinctions (such as Wilderness boundaries).

Recreationists were asked to choose from a list all of the activities participated in and also one primary activity. For the satisfaction items, Likert-type scales were used to assess service quality items (5-point scale), overall satisfaction (6-point scale), and trip experience items (5-point scale). Motivation items included the most important reason for visit and the importance of specific reasons for recreating in the study area (5-point scale). Visitors were also asked if they were aware of the river’s federal designation and if that awareness had any influence on their decision to visit.

For crowding and conflict, a battery of items was used and included multiple Likert-type scales. This included a bivalent scale, modified from the traditional 9-point crowding (Heberlein

& Vaske, 1977) scale. It asked visitors how the number of people they saw affected their trip enjoyment (1 = enhanced my enjoyment, 9 = reduced my enjoyment) regarding the number of 41 people seen at trails, at the visitor’s campsite, on the river, and overall. Finally, the survey included a few qualitative items in the forms of open-ended questions that asked visitors about suggestions for management and what they liked most and least about the area.

Data Collection. Recreation surveys were conducted from mid June through early

August 2014 at trailheads and other locations which provide access to the river. Forest Service managers were consulted in order to determine the best locations and times of day for conducting surveys. They identified six trailheads that were believed to provide the most popular access to the Wenaha river corridor. However, only four of these sites were sampled regularly for this study, for two reasons. First, one trailhead (Three Forks), showed little to no sign of use throughout the period of data collection, and so it was sampled less frequently. Second, the

Grizzly Bear trailhead was not sampled as it was located far from the other sampling locations and was inaccessible by passenger car throughout most of the data collection period. However, field employees were consulted regularly throughout the summer regarding both sites to find out if visitor use was increasing at these locations, and it was not. Timothy Springs was suggested as a potential sampling site. Managers expected this site to have lower use and to provide less information about use in the Wenaha corridor because of its relatively long distance (11 miles) from the river’s protected portion. This trailhead was visited twice. Locations are described in

Table 4.

42

Table 4. Survey Sites Included in Study Location Access Description

Cross Canyon TH Accesses wild section Elk Flat TH Accesses wild section Hoodoo TH Accesses wild section Three Forks TH Accesses wild section Timothy Springs TH Accesses Wenaha River Trail (from west) Troy TH Accesses Wenaha River Trail (from east) Troy (Private) Developed campsites (privately owned) on recreational section Troy (Public) Developed campsites (state public lands) on recreational and scenic sections Troy (Other) Accesses the recreational section; these include all areas within the river corridor that are not included in the privately-owned or state- managed camping areas

For trailhead surveys, recreationists were approached as they exited the trail. For the other survey sites in Troy, recreationists were approached at or near the end of their visits. A total of 74 surveys was collected. Only one visitor declined to be interviewed for a response rate of 98.7%. Respondents were randomly selected from each group and only included those 16 years of age or older. Efforts were made to sample each survey location at various times of day and on weekdays and weekends. However, due to the low use nature of the study area it did not make sense to sample each location within strict time blocks as trailheads were often empty.

Ultimately convenience sampling was used in order to obtain the largest sample possible.

Sampling decisions were made based on use patterns that the interviewer noted early in the sampling timeframe for each location. For example, recreationists camping in Troy were likely to exit the study area earlier in the day than the overnight visitors (or day use visitors) coming out of the river corridor, and therefore the interviewer was positioned accordingly. Because sites were not randomly sampled and equal time was not spent at each site, the percentage of hours spent at each location is shown in Table 5. (All survey site locations for Troy were combined 43 regarding time spent there because of their close proximity; all sites could be monitored simultaneously by the interviewer.)

Table 5. Percentage of Survey Hours Spent at each Sampling Location Valid Percent

Survey Site Location Cross Canyon TH 32.7 Elk Flat TH 27.9 Hoodoo TH 8.3 Three Forks TH 2.9 Timothy Springs TH <1 Troy (All locations) 27.8 Percentages may not equal 100 percent because of rounding.

The survey was conducted using either traditional paper-and-clipboard method (n=38) or electronically (n=36). For both modes, the interviewer recorded all responses. The hardware used for electronic data collection was a Nextbook Android tablet. Prior to data collection the survey instrument was typed into the droidsurvey software application. This application was then used to conduct the actual survey in the field. Last, the application was used to automatically upload the results into the Statistical Package for the Social Sciences (SPSS). Paper survey results were typed into the same application on the tablets and then uploaded into SPSS.

Vehicle Counts

Vehicle counts can be used in relation to people at one time (PAOT) in an area which helps inform visitor capacity decisions (Lawson, Manning, Valliere, Wang, & Badruk, 2002).

Vehicle counts were conducted upon arrival and departure from the same locations as survey sites. Following the same method as this Forest Service capacity analysis (USDA, 2013), vehicles at trailheads or other locations with attached trailers (of all types) were counted as one vehicle. Separate counts were also conducted as very often trailers were not present. While 44 vehicle counts were recorded for public/street parking in Troy, it was determined early in data collection that vehicles parked at this location were vehicles staged for Grand Ronde private rafters or commercial outfitters, and were not vehicles utilized by visitors accessing to the

Wenaha. Counts for these areas are not reported in this thesis. Also following the capacity analysis methodology, vehicles at all 20 campsites were included for the Troy private campground count, though 13 of these are technically on the Grande Ronde River just past the mouth of the Wenaha. For the Elk Flat Trailhead (TH), vehicles or trailers are often parked on

Road 290 in a location approximately 0.25 miles from the actual trailhead. These vehicles were included in the Elk Flat TH count. Counts were recorded on paper to be entered into a spreadsheet every time the interviewer arrived or departed a survey site location. Counts were later uploaded from Excel into SPSS.

Ocular Data

Reporting field observations can supplement quantitative research. This provides context and can result in richer explanations than quantitative reporting alone (Sieber, 1973), and the combination qualitative and quantitative research methods has garnered support among many scholars (Axinn & Pearce, 2006; Onwuegbuzie & Leech, 2005). Ocular data were collected for this thesis via field notes and photographs at survey locations and on trails within the study area.

Observations were determined noteworthy based on knowledge gathered both prior to and during data collection, especially if observations were made that were not addressed by the survey. For example, the presence of campsite litter was noticed but the survey instrument did not include items related to this issue. This was considered important as results from the 2011 capacity analysis defined this as inappropriate use and a threat to visitor capacity.

Group Size

Data collected during the sampling period suggested that group sizes were appropriate for the areas evaluated. Group size is regulated in Wilderness in order to provide “outstanding opportunities for solitude” as specified in the Wilderness Act. Regulating group size also can be used to uphold the Wild and Scenic Rivers Act for those rivers that have been identified as possessing recreation as an outstandingly remarkable value, because regulating group size protects social carrying capacity. While federal legislation does not specify group sizes in

Wilderness, land management agencies do so. Therefore, Forest Service (secondary) and other agency (tertiary) documents were used to evaluate appropriate group size for the area.

The Wenaha-Tucannon Wilderness Management Plan (Wilderness Plan) (1989) specifies the maximum group size as 12 persons/18 head of stock for those areas in Wilderness.

The Revised Forest Plan (2014) and the Comprehensive River Management Plan (CRMP) (2015) reflects this. The CRMP also proposed a new standard that would extend this limitation of 12 persons/18 head of stock for that portion of the wild river segment that is outside of Wilderness.

While the CRMP cannot enforce group size for lands outside of Forest boundaries, another guideline proposed by the CRMP is that those non-Forest entities which manage the scenic river section should incorporate a group size limit that is consistent with these limits within the wild section. However, this limit has yet to be determined. No known state or other document addresses group size limits for the scenic nor recreational segment, and therefore this measure 81 could not be applied in these areas. The CRMP does recommend a maximum number of people at one time (PAOT) for the entire river corridor, a measure used in tandem with vehicle capacity recommendations. This will be discussed later in the section “vehicle use.”

The mean group size reported by this study was 3.97. Only one group was larger than 12 and was a party of 30 on the private campground in Troy on a holiday weekend. There were only three groups as large as 12 people that were interviewed and these also recreated outside of the

Forest boundary. Larger groups recreating within those areas with group size regulations included two parties of 11 at the Elk Flat trailhead (a volunteer pack string and another group on horseback), and one group of 11 backpacking via the Cross Canyon trail. No groups included more than 12 people or 18 head of stock. Group sizes were thus determined as appropriate as shown in Table 43.

Group Encounters

The number of times recreationists encounter other groups is another indicator that managers can investigate in order to protect opportunities for solitude in Wilderness and social carrying capacity in general. The CRMP and the Wilderness Plan were the only documents that 82 addressed group encounters for the study area. Table 44 shows that use is appropriate for all areas that could be evaluated using this measure. The CRMP states that encounters of no more than 3-6 other groups within the river corridor (excluding the recreational section) are appropriate, allowing for more encounters during “peak visitation” which includes about 10 days per year. The mean number of encounters with other groups during the sampling period in the corridor was < 1.00 (0.97). This number excludes those who only used the recreational section and/or that portion of the scenic section which is the state campground. As this mean number of encounters was well below the 3-6 group encounter threshold identified in the CRMP, use was appropriate in the corridor according to this measure. Use outside of the corridor in Wilderness was also appropriate. For those visitors who recreated in non-corridor, Wilderness areas (n=11) the mean number of other groups encountered was 1.00. This number is appropriate according to the standard set by the Wilderness Plan (1989), which states that this semi-primitive Wilderness area should maintain an 80% probability of encountering 10 or less other groups per day.

Vehicle Use

Appropriateness of vehicle use was assessed by comparing vehicle counts during the sampling period with thresholds outlined by Forest Service documents. This quantitative data showed that use is appropriate pertaining to numbers of vehicles as shown in Tables 45, 46, and

47. Ocular data revealed some inappropriate use regarding the exact locations of where visitors are choosing to park at trailheads and other locations, and also two isolated cases where vehicle use violated specific Wilderness restrictions (Table 47).

Vehicle count data collected were compared to the recommended standard set by the

CRMP (2015). One method used by the Forest Service to estimate visitor use and to set use limits is through associating numbers of vehicles with numbers of people at one time (PAOT), where one vehicle represents a count of four PAOT. Specific thresholds were identified in this document and were based on results from the capacity analysis conducted in 2011. The CRMP focused on the total vehicle capacity for only those trailheads which most easily access the corridor, and set this standard at 50 vehicles. This includes the total number of vehicles parked at the Troy, Hoodoo, Cross Canyon, Elk Flat, and trailheads. It does not include the

Three Forks trailhead. Table 45 displays how the maximum use recorded during the sampling period compares to the Forest Service’s recommended standard. Even when considering the maximum number recorded for all trailheads simultaneously, the total count (N=26) of vehicles is only half of the set standard (50 vehicles). While the Grizzly Bear trailhead was not sampled during data collection for this thesis, contact with Forest Service employees during the sampling period about this trailhead suggested little use and it is doubtful that its exclusion would affect results shown here. 84

Table 45. Vehicle Counts at Trailheads Compared to Capacity Standard Maximum Count Recommended Capacity Recorded (Summer 2014) (USDA 2015)

Site location Cross Canyon TH 9 -- Elk Flat TH 11 -- Hoodoo TH 4 -- Three Forks TH 0 N/A Grizzly Bear TH N/A -- Troy TH 2 -- Total 26 50

The Forest Service did not set a standard for the private campground in Troy and the state campground, as the agency cannot enforce standards on non-Forest lands. No known state or other document reports vehicle capacity or sets standards for vehicle capacity for these areas.

However, the capacity analysis (USDA, 2013) examined these areas because high use levels could negatively affect visitor capacity in the study area, and the results of this analysis are helpful for the comparison of vehicle counts collected during the sampling timeframe in these areas. The Forest Service lists 20 vehicles as the capacity for the private campground in Troy

(which includes the seven campsites on the Wenaha and 13 campsites which are on the Grande

Ronde River.) The maximum count recorded at one time by this study was 21 vehicles (including trailers) but the mean for the entire sampling period was 1.95. For state lands, capacity is reported as 10 vehicles. Again, one high use day yielded 12 vehicles, but the mean here was

1.03. Table 46 compares the maximum vehicle counts recorded on state and private lands compared to the existing capacity reported in the capacity analysis (2013). 85

Table 46. Vehicle Counts on State and Private Lands Compared to Existing Capacity Maximum Count Existing Capacity Mean* Recorded (USDA 2013) (Summer 2014)

Site location Public 12 10 1.03 Private 21 20 1.95

*The mean reported is for the count of vehicles (including trailers) upon arrival and is for the entire sampling period.

The comparison of vehicle counts during the sampling period with thresholds outlined in

Forest Service documents led to the conclusion that use of vehicles and parking areas, with regard to numbers of vehicles is appropriate for the study area, as shown in Table 47.

Ocular data regarding exact locations of parked vehicles supplement the quantitative data in the evaluation of appropriate use of vehicles. Exact locations of vehicles are important because the 2011 capacity analysis identified one inappropriate use as “parking capacity exceeded and visitors choosing to park in vegetation, illegally on private lands, and in other undesirable locations” (p.11). For the areas which are outside of Forest Service jurisdiction, which include the Troy private campground and the state (public) campground, vehicles are allowed in all areas and so this measure is not applicable. For those trailheads managed by the

Forest Service (which are included in Table 5 under non-corridor, not in Wilderness, photographs were taken when vehicles were parked in areas other than those specifically designated for parking. When vehicles were observed parked outside of the designated parking area at Cross Canyon, they were typically parked just off of the road under trees, within the vicinity of the trailhead. Figure 6 is an example. Even when parking space was ample, this behavior was observed on several occasions at the Cross Canyon and Elk Flat trailheads, and occasionally at the less-used Hoodoo trailhead. At Elk Flat, two areas are designated as parking 86 for visitors, at the trailhead and also a location where vehicles with trailers can use a pull out area approximately 0.20 miles from the trailhead, on the south side of FS 290. Vehicles that parked outside of these two designated parking locations were observed parked under trees either in the immediate trailhead vicinity or on the north side of FS 290. One group scouting for elk season

Figure 6. Visitors Parked in Vegetation. The access road for the Cross Canyon trail ends just past the trailhead. Visitors sometimes park in vegetation here, presumably seeking shade on hot summer days. reported that they chose to park and camp along FS 290 rather than at the trailhead campsite in order to avoid paying the fee. (Elk Flat was the only fee site other than the Three Forks trailhead in the study area.) At the Hoodoo trailhead, vehicles sometimes parked outside of the turnaround at the trailhead where shade is provided, rather than the pullout on FS 6214 where parking is available. No ocular data was collected at the Three Forks trailhead as no vehicles were counted here. While no vehicles were observed at the Troy trailhead outside of the designated parking 87 area, some Troy residents reported that parking in this area has been a problem in the past. The parking area is small and located at a hairpin turn on Bartlett Road. It was said that vehicles often park along this narrow and steep road making it difficult for traffic to navigate.

Exact locations of vehicles are also important with concern to federally designated

Wilderness. Ocular data showed some isolated yet notable cases of violations of the Wilderness

Act. On one occasion, a vehicle with a trailer was parked in Wilderness on the north side of FS

290 in the Elk Flat trailhead area (included in Table 47 under Non-corridor, Wilderness). One other isolated example was a group that was unique in their chosen recreational activity of transporting an inflatable raft via the Hoodoo trail to the river and floating to the town of Troy

(included in Table 47 under Wild river section, in Wilderness). While this is an appropriate use, the wheeled vessel utilized to transport the raft through Wilderness violates the Wilderness Act’s prohibition of mechanical transport (section 4(c)), and the Revised Forest Plan’s more specific prohibition of “wheel vehicles such as wagons or game carts” (USDA, 2014).

Recreational Activities

Recreational activities in the study area were generally appropriate as shown in Table 48, with ocular data noting exceptions. “Recreational activities” included all recreational activity survey items listed on the survey instrument. Respondents chose which activities they participated in. Each activity was evaluated to ensure that the activity was appropriate for all areas of the river corridor and non-corridor areas during the sampling timeframe. All were appropriate. (Note: Three exceptions would have occurred had visitors reported participation, but no respondents reported these activities. They were: bicycling (in Wilderness), and hunting

(outside of appropriate hunting seasons). A third exception would have occurred had fire restrictions increased from Phase A to Phase B during the sampling timeframe, in which case the 89 activity of gathering firewood would have been cause for concern. However, public use restrictions did not increase until after the sampling timeframe was over.)

Ocular data supplemented survey results and did identify some instances of inappropriate use. The most notable pertained to campsites. The 2011 capacity analysis conducted by the

Forest Service included an impact assessment of 131 campsites (USDA, 2013). Each campsite was rated based on the presence of ground disturbance, tree damage, area disturbance, litter, human waste, weeds, user-created trails, and an overall impact rating (Cole, 1983). Results showed a “low” overall impact rating for 128 of the 131 campsites of the corridor, and the remaining three showed “moderate” impact.

The interviewer visited a small number of these campsites, and photographs were taken to supplement as ocular data. Campsites that were visited were generally located at trail intersections, where Umatilla managers expected the most use to be occurring. Campsite impact ratings from the data collected in 2011 showed that sometimes these were the areas that were more heavily impacted, though this was not always the case (USDA, 2013c). Photographs were often taken to document inappropriate use, but these were exceptional cases and should not be interpreted as representative of campsite use of the study area.

Some corridor campsites were within a few steps of the river. While the CRMP does not directly address campsite proximity to the river, the Revised Forest Plan (2014) prohibits camping and campfires “within 200 feet of lakes, streams, or other camps within wilderness areas.” The CRMP does address campsite litter. Campsite litter within close proximity to the river was identified in the capacity analysis as a threat to all of the river’s ORVs (recreation, scenery, wildlife, and fisheries) (USDA, 2013b). The interviewer did not utilize the methodology employed by the Umatilla NF for the capacity analysis, but the presence of litter at campsites 90 that were visited was noted. It is probable that the littered campsites that were noted during the sampling timeframe would have had higher impact ratings than the ratings recorded for the capacity analysis. In fact, data recorded in 2011 pertaining to litter in the corridor was rated as very low. On a scale of ‘1’ (low) through ‘8’ (high), only one of 131 assessed sites rated as ‘4’ and one rated as ‘2.’ The remainder rated as ‘1’ or below. Some of the littered sites observed were in the wild section of the corridor, in Wilderness, as displayed in Figure 7. These were often very close to the river, much closer than the 200 foot distance required in the Revised Forest Plan

(Two were within ¼ mile of the Cross Canyon/Wenaha River Trail intersection; two were within one mile of the Hoodoo trail’s intersection with the unofficial trail along the south bank of the

Wenaha; and two were at the base of the Elk Flat trail in the Wenaha Forks area.) No littered campsites were observed in the wild section, not in Wilderness. One time litter was recorded at the campsite at the Hoodoo trailhead (non-corridor, not in Wilderness). 91

Figure 7. A Littered Campsite Along the Wild River Section in Wilderness. While littered campsites were rarely encountered during the sampling timeframe, these were documented as littered campsites are a threat to all of the Wenaha’s ORVs.

The south side of the scenic section of the river includes most of the State campsites, and two of these contained litter. This area is defined as “related adjacent land” for the Grande Ronde

Scenic Waterway (OAR 736-040-0015) and therefore the specific Oregon Administrative Rule

(OAR) for this state protected land applies (766-040-0047). This OAR prohibits littering

(5)(d)(A). Further, it is notable that most of the campground’s fire rings are rock rings, and this

OAR specifies that “fire shall be contained in a fireproof container with sides of a height sufficient to contain all ash and debris” (5)(c)(A). This will be discussed more in Chapter 5. On the northern and more remote bank of the river, one littered campsite was noted. The south side of the recreational section includes three campsites on State lands. An example showing the proximity of some sites to the river is illustrated by Figure 8. Two of the three were 92 photographed for the presence of litter. No littered campsites were observed at any time on the north side of the recreational section, where the seven private campsites exist in Troy. For these recreational and scenic sections, there are no restrictions pertaining to campsite proximity from the river.

Figure 8. A Campsite on the State Campground. While this site contains a metal fire ring to contain ash and debris, many state campsites only have rock rings. This figure illustrates the close proximity of campsites in this area to the Wenaha.

Some user-developed trails and trail impacts were noted through ocular data. According to the capacity analysis, one inappropriate use identified as having a higher potential impact on visitor capacity is “unmanaged recreation use causing excessive permanent destruction of vegetation or multiple user-developed trails; especially along the banks of the river” (pp. 9, 11).

Some evidence of user-developed trails were noted in all sections of the river corridor. The interviewer hiked all of the trails at least once during the sampling timeframe searching for these 93 and also for trail impacts on official trails. Only portions of the Three Forks and Wenaha River trails were hiked. Very rarely were user-developed trails or trail impacts observed. Exceptions included some unofficial trails that appeared in the north scenic section of the corridor, leading from the Wenaha River trail to campsites and river access areas. Some trail impacts were observed along the trails leading into the corridor (Non-Corridor, Wilderness). The Cross

Canyon trail included an isolated muddy area where trail widening may be beginning to occur.

Braiding has occurred in one spot within one mile of the trailhead. The Elk Flat trail contains several areas within its five miles where impact is occurring. This could be due to a number of factors, such as pack animals (as this is a popular trail for horse packers) and soil characteristics such as depth to water table.

Two isolated cases (shown as “other ocular evidence” in Table 48) are reported here. A portion of the sampling period included fire restrictions (USDA, 2014; ODF, 2014) which are posted and enforced by state and federal agencies. It was a violation (at both levels) to use a chainsaw between the hours of 13:00 and 20:00 beginning July 15, 2014. On one occasion this was observed near the Cross Canyon trailhead (Non-Corridor, not in Wilderness) and was reported to law enforcement by the interviewer. Another group included pack goats on the Elk

Flat trail (Wild river section, Wilderness). “Grazing of domestic sheep and/or goats” is considered to be an inappropriate use with lower potential impact on visitor capacity as it could have an effect on the wildlife ORV (USDA, 2103).

Discussion and Conclusions

Two broad discussion items follow from those outlined in the discussion for each research question above. First, throughout the course of this study it became very clear that this unique location is meticulously managed. Evidence supporting this firm conclusion is abundant.

As results showed, recreationists are very satisfied and recreational use is generally appropriate for this low-use, highly protected area. Ocular data that suggested otherwise have been clearly and thoughtfully addressed by the new standards and guidelines developed long before the study before this thesis took place, and which were incorporated into the Final CRMP implemented in

July of 2015. Managers and other Forest Service personnel, many of which have worked on the

Forest for many years, were very engaged throughout the course of this study, exhibiting a breadth of knowledge of the study area along with tireless dedication to resource and river value protection.

The second discussion item regards the overlapping jurisdictions within the study area and how this can be approached, especially if recreational use increases in the future, and especially in the wake of the Grizzly Bear Complex Fire. The study area for this thesis, like 110 many protected areas, included multiple overlapping jurisdictions. The inherent administrative complications that can arise in these situations have presented challenges for land managers for a long time (Lewis & Marsh, 1977). The most specific direction for the study area comes from

Forest Service documents, which is not surprising as the Forest Service is named as the administrative authority of the Wenaha. However, the Forest Service cannot enforce regulations outside of its boundaries, and few specific rules and regulations pertaining to recreation in the

Wenaha corridor are defined for those portions of the study area which are on non-Forest lands.

In cases of areas with overlapping jurisdictions, agencies tend to default to the more specific management plans and policies developed by other agencies for a given area, and rightly so. Nevertheless, confusion can still occur. For example, on one occasion during a conversation with an agency representative it was explained that on the state campground, BLM rules are followed (because of the Grande Ronde River’s federal designation). On a separate occasion but regarding the same topic, a BLM employee explained that the BLM has no authority over state land at all, and that the state must regulate its own lands. If the State wished to follow BLM rules here, then regulations should have been developed requiring mandatory firepans as prescribed by the Wallowa and Grande Ronde Rivers Management Plan (BLM, 1993, p. 138). If the state were to follow its own Oregon Administrative Rules (OARs), the rock fire rings still are inappropriate for this area, as they violate the OAR which specifies that fire should be contained within fireproof containers within the state-protected Grande Ronde Scenic Waterway (section (5)(c)(A) which includes this portion of the Wenaha river corridor.

This is an example that illustrates the difficulties that can arise when multiple agencies are involved in managing an area. Interagency councils have been created in recent decades to help coordinate management of complex areas such as Wildernesses (Interagency Wilderness 111

Policy Council) and Wild and Scenic Rivers (Interagency Wild and Scenic Rivers Coordinating

Council) and recently, the Interagency Visitor Use Management Council was formed to focus specifically on visitor use management on federal lands (IVUMC, 2015). However, all three of these councils are comprised of exclusively federal land management agencies. No state or other entities are included. Therefore, it is up to federal agencies to engage these other entities to ensure that the details of management plans are understood and applied.

As previously mentioned, the Forest Service is very aware of other agency plans and activities in the study area and have incorporated that consideration into Forest Service management plans. Further, the CRMP (2015) proposed a “cooperative management” guideline, which will encourage other agencies to adopt a group size limit on non-Forest lands (in the scenic river corridor section) that is comparable to Forest Service limitations. Cooperative management will be very important for the non-Forest lands of this study area, especially if recreational use increases, which is possible according to some of the plans analyzed for this thesis. Numbers of visitors would likely increase on the more accessible scenic and recreational sections of the river corridor which are outside of Forest Service boundaries. Therefore, future collaboration among agencies might be warranted in order to ensure those visitor capacity thresholds defined for the CRMP are not exceeded. In September 2015 the U.S. Fish and

Wildlife Service decided to not add the Greater Sage Grouse to the list of federally endangered species. The Baker Resource Management Plan (BLM, 2011), which applies to a portion of the study area, was on hold for development pending this decision. The BLM can now resume progress on the draft plan, offering an opportunity for the Forest Service and the BLM to ensure consistency in agency planning.

112

Cooperative management also must consider those private citizens and landowners in

Troy and surrounding communities. These relationships should continue to be nurtured in order to effectively manage non-Forest lands. As previously stated, it is one couple that currently owns and maintains Troy’s only restaurant and bath/laundry, all rental cabins in the river corridor, a big game processing building, the land which is leased to hunters and anglers for seasonal wall tent occupation, and the private campground. As noted in Chapter 4, not once was litter reported or observed at these campsites. It is also this couple that stayed in Troy after a Level 3 evacuation notice (representing the most severe circumstances) in order to provide additional support to firefighters for the Grizzly Bear Complex Fire. The Forest Service would do well to ensure that the relationship with this family remains open and supportive. Should ownership and management of this property change hands in the future, the Forest Service should be very attentive to new actions and development that takes place in this most accessible area of the river corridor.

Suggestions for Future Research

It is appreciated here that all management plans, policies and legislation (as well as theses) are developed within a dynamic context. Future research about recreation in the study area should be developed as progress moves forward in response to the Grizzly Bear Complex

Fire. At the time this thesis was written it was too soon to speculate about potential outcomes.

However, this event will undoubtedly offer opportunities to strengthen interagency collaboration, reinforce relationships with the public, and proactively address any management concerns that existed prior to the incident when the Forest Service begins reestablishing recreational facilities.

As previously noted, future research in the study area should reevaluate use and use levels if recreation increases in the study area. Some of the indicators utilized by the capacity 113 analysis (USDA, 2011) and the resulting Comprehensive River Management Plan (USDA, 2015) regarding group size limitations, number of other group encounters, campsites, and vehicle capacity provided measures for the comparison of data collected for this thesis. Future research could also use these measures for evaluating visitor capacity.

Last, while no place attachment items were included for this study, future research deserves this consideration as visitors who exhibit place attachment can be helpful in public land management (Smaldone, Harris, Sanyal, & Lind, 2005). Local recreationists often exuded a certain reverence for the study area during interviews. One Troy resident described her community as feeling “fiercely protective” of the river. In fact, she admitted initially having felt suspicious about the interviewer’s intentions upon her arrival to the study area, as data collection came about after a Troy Town Hall meeting with the Forest Service during the scoping phase for the development of the Revised Forest Plan. The Incident Commander for the aforementioned wildfire incident commented that he was "humbled by the community response” (East

Oregonian, 2015, August 24). Area residents are clearly dedicated to the protection of the outstandingly remarkable values of the Wenaha Wild and Scenic River in this treasured portion of the Blue Mountains.
